Output defbf0d2c49833a8a23ee68792414c7b54f2cad139cbf01fc2c81e1d8648093b:42

value
38125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ca46186f4529e54dc74820f959a5a5f198c3cd7 OP_EQUAL
address
3BbTpeijC5sUdjVHVUN5K7sPZrJXnACUbj
transaction
defbf0d2c49833a8a23ee68792414c7b54f2cad139cbf01fc2c81e1d8648093b
spent
true